Our Verdict
The Ferrari 849 Testarossa arrives in India as a halo supercar that blends classic Testarossa heritage with cutting‑edge hybrid technology. Its 4.0‑litre twin‑turbo V8 paired with a 48‑volt electric assist delivers a jaw‑dropping 720 hp, propelling the car from 0‑100 km/h in 2.7 seconds and topping out at 340 km/h. The chassis is a carbon‑fiber monocoque with active aerodynamics, offering razor‑sharp handling on both city streets and the winding mountain passes of the Western Ghats. Inside, the cabin is a blend of minimalist driver‑focus ergonomics and bespoke luxury, featuring a digital instrument cluster, adaptive sport seats, and a premium infotainment system tuned for Indian languages. Safety is bolstered by a full suite of ADAS, carbon‑ceramic brakes, and a robust roll‑cage, though the low ride height can be a challenge on uneven Indian roads. Fuel efficiency sits at a modest 7 km/l (combined), typical for a supercar, but the mild‑hybrid system recovers some energy during city traffic. Ownership costs are high due to steep import duties, limited service network, and premium insurance, yet the brand cachet and exclusivity justify the price for affluent enthusiasts. Practicality is limited to two seats and minimal luggage, making it a weekend or track toy rather than a daily driver. Overall, the 849 Testarossa is a statement of performance and prestige, best suited for collectors who value heritage, technology, and unrivaled driving thrills.
vs Competitors
Against rivals like the Lamborghini Aventador SVJ and McLaren 720S, the 849 Testarossa offers comparable straight‑line speed but edges ahead with its hybrid efficiency and classic Ferrari styling. However, the Aventador provides a more raw V12 experience, while the 720S boasts superior daily usability thanks to its slightly higher ride height and broader dealer network in India.
